notes: |
|
|
emux is a multi-system emulator supporting CHIP-8, Game Boy, NES, and
|
|
Sega Master System as separate libretro cores. The CHIP-8 core
|
|
(emux_chip8) does not require any external BIOS or firmware files.
|
|
|
|
The CHIP-8 architecture has no real BIOS. The standard font/character
|
|
set (hex digits 0-F, 5 bytes each = 80 bytes) is hardcoded in
|
|
mach/chip8.c:40-57 as the char_mem[] array. On reset, this font data
|
|
is copied into the beginning of the 4 KB RAM (address 0x000-0x04F)
|
|
via memcpy in chip8_reset() at mach/chip8.c:105.
|
|
|
|
ROM loading: the game ROM is loaded via file_open(PATH_DATA, ...) in
|
|
chip8_init() at mach/chip8.c:68-74. On reset, ROM contents are copied
|
|
into RAM starting at address 0x200 (mach/chip8.c:113). The core
|
|
accepts .ch8, .bin, and .rom extensions (libretro/Makefile.rules:20).
|
|
|
|
Memory map from mach/chip8.c:17-20:
|
|
0x000-0x04F font/character data (hardcoded)
|
|
0x050-0x1FF unused
|
|
0x200-0xFFF program ROM + working RAM
|
|
|
|
The libretro frontend retrieves the system directory via
|
|
RETRO_ENVIRONMENT_GET_SYSTEM_DIRECTORY (libretro/libretro.c:34) but
|
|
only uses it as a general config path, not for BIOS loading.
